Explain why nucleophilic substitution reactions rae not very common in phenols.

Text Solution

AI Generated Solution

To explain why nucleophilic substitution reactions are not very common in phenols, we can break down the reasoning into several steps: ### Step-by-Step Solution: 1. **Understanding the Structure of Phenols**: - Phenols are compounds where a hydroxyl group (-OH) is directly attached to an aromatic ring. The aromatic ring consists of sp² hybridized carbon atoms, which are part of a conjugated π-electron system. 2. **Resonance Stabilization**: ...
